For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 756 students in Merrimack Valley School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in New Hampshire.
Public High School in Merrimack Valley School District have an average math proficiency score of 17% (versus the New Hampshire public high school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 61% statewide average).
Public High School in Merrimack Valley School District have a Graduation Rate of 92%, which is more than the New Hampshire average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Merrimack Valley High School, with 90-94%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in New Hampshire or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the New Hampshire public high school average of 17%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$19,860 in this school district is less than the state median of $22,101.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$19,339 is less than the state median of $21,319.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
